The energy grid operator National Grid has awarded £3.1bn worth of contracts to companies including the construction group Balfour Beatty to upgrade its gas distribution systems.
National Grid has handed out a total of four, eight-year contracts covering its networks in the North West, Midlands, East and London. Morrison Utility Services and the Swedish engineering company Skanska were also awarded contracts.
